Why Charlie Catches a Leprechaun is the best Saint Patrick's episode.

For Saint Patrick's Day, here is my review of the episode Charlie Catches a Leprechaun. This is on my list of best episodes of It's Always Sunny, and it's the episode you have to watch every Saint Patrick's Day because it is so funny. The episode starts with the gang planning Saint Patrick's Day for their bar, and, of course, they talk about whether Saint Patrick was a pedo but he actually drove the snakes out of Ireland. The whole episode has Dennis create the Paddy Band Waggon, where they take total strangers, give them drinks, and take away their phones, leaving them in the middle of nowhere. Now the funniest storyline is when Charlie wants to capture a leprechaun, but the gang keeps telling him they are not real. However, Charlie ends up capturing a little person whom he thinks is a leprechaun. Mac doesn't believe until he even starts to think he's a leprechaun. The guy says he's not until he does say he is just to get out of the trap Charlie set up. The guys still won't let release him until he tells them were the pot of gold is. Now, later at Paddy's, Mac leaves to go to a gay bar, and basically, Paddy's gets ransacked as everyone steals the drinks and money from the pub. As well, someone was robbing customers' wallets at Paddy's, and wasn't just Dennis in the paddy wagon; Dennis took away the phones, too. 
Now again, the best moments are with Charlie, and in this scene, he actually drinks green paint. He later tries to cut the guy's neck to see if he bleeds green. Until the guys stops him and they learn from Mac this is the guy who was the pickpocketer at the pub, stealing wallets from customers. He even kept trying to tell Charlie but Charlie he was saying he was a leprechaun. If you look at Dee in this scene she's holding in her laughter.
So the gang drops him off in the middle of nowhere like everyone else they did, and Charlie looks back, and he flies up a rainbow. Charlie shouts that he flew up on a rainbow, and the gang looks back, replying. "Stop drinking paint, Charlie," and continues to do it.
